Built In Bookcase Installation in Durham, NC
Built-in bookcase installation services provide a tailored solution for homeowners seeking to maximize storage and enhance the aesthetic appeal of their living spaces. These services typically involve custom-fitting shelving units directly into existing wall spaces, whether in living rooms, home offices, bedrooms, or libraries. Projects can range from adding built-in shelves around windows or fireplaces to creating entire wall units designed to hold books, decorative items, or multimedia equipment. Property owners often want to understand the scope of customization available, the materials used, and how the installation can seamlessly blend with existing decor.
Before requesting built-in bookcase installation, property owners usually consider factors such as the dimensions of the space, the style of the room, and the type of storage needed. It’s helpful to have measurements and a clear idea of the desired look-whether traditional, modern, or rustic. Understanding the structural aspects of the wall, such as whether it’s drywall or a studded surface, can influence the installation process. Clarifying preferences for materials, finishes, and any additional features like lighting or adjustable shelves can ensure the final result aligns with the overall design goals.

Built In Bookcase Installation Questions
What types of built-in bookcases are available for installation? There are various styles, including traditional, modern, and custom designs, to match different interior aesthetics.
Where can built-in bookcases be installed in a home? They can be integrated into living rooms, home offices, bedrooms, or around staircases for added storage and decor.
What should property owners consider before installing a built-in bookcase? It’s important to assess space dimensions, wall structure, and the desired style to ensure proper fit and functionality.
Are built-in bookcases suitable for all types of walls? They work best on solid, load-bearing walls but can be adapted for other wall types with proper support and framing.
